Cope

02319 Cope, v. t. 1. To bargain for; to buy. mark [Obs.]2. To make return for; to requite; to repay. mark [Obs.]three thousand ducats due unto the Jew,
We freely cope your courteous pains withal.
Shak.3. To match one's self against; to meet; to encounter.I love to cope him in these sullen fits.
Shak.They say he yesterday coped Hector in the battle, and struck him down.
Shak.

Cordillera

02323 Cor*dil"ler*a (k?r-d?l"l?r-?; Sp. k?r`d?-ly?"r?), n. [Sp., fr. OSp. cordilla, cordiella, dim. of cuerda a rope, string. See Cord.] (Geol.) A mountain ridge or chain. note &hand; Cordillera is sometimes applied, in geology, to the system of mountain chains near the border of a continent; thus, the western cordillera of North America in the United States includes the Rocky Mountains, Sierra Nevada, Coast and Cascade ranges. /note
